Understanding VSCO and Its Unique Features

VSCO is not just a photo editing app; it is a platform for artistic expression and community engagement. Key features that set VSCO apart include:
- Editing Tools: Powerful and intuitive editing tools help users enhance their photos with filters and adjustments.
- Journal: The Journal feature allows users to share their thoughts and inspirations alongside their images, creating a narrative experience.
- Community: Users can follow one another, like images, and even make connections through shared interests.
- Visual Identity: User profiles reflect personal style, showcasing favorite edits and conveying a unique aesthetic.
By understanding these features, users can leverage VSCO's strengths to create a more engaging and visually appealing profile that stands out in a sea of content.

3. Choosing the Right Aesthetic for Your VSCO Account
When it comes to making an impression on VSCO, *choosing the right aesthetic* is crucial. Your aesthetic not only reflects your personality but also sets the tone for your entire profile. Here are some tips to help you find the perfect vibe:
- Identify Your Interests: Think about what you love. Is it nature, urban life, or maybe fashion? Pinpointing your interests will guide your aesthetic choices.
- Color Palette: Consistency is key! Choose a color palette that resonates with you. Warm tones often evoke feelings of coziness while cooler tones might feel more calm and serene.
- Editing Style: Your editing style can greatly affect the overall look of your photos. Do you prefer light and airy edits, or are you more into moody and dramatic styles? Stick with what feels right to you.
- Inspiration: Browse through VSCO and other platforms like Instagram or Pinterest. Take note of profiles and photos that catch your eye—what do they have in common?
After you’ve established your aesthetic, remember to stick to it! Your followers will appreciate a cohesive look that tells a story. Over time, your aesthetic will distinguish your profile and create a memorable visual identity.

4. How to Optimize Your Profile Picture
Your profile picture is essentially your first impression on VSCO, and it plays a significant role in attracting followers. Here are some tips on how to make sure your profile picture shines:
- Choose a Clear Image: Make sure your photo is high quality and clear. Avoid blurry or pixelated images as they can make your profile look unprofessional.
- Show Your Face: If you’re comfortable, use a picture of yourself! It adds a personal touch that helps people connect with you. If you prefer not to show your face, choose an image that best represents your aesthetic or style.
- Maintain Consistency: If you’re active on other platforms, use the same profile picture across all accounts. This consistency helps with branding and recognition.
- Keep it Simple: Profile pictures are small, so avoid busy backgrounds or overly complicated images. Select something simple that highlights you or your brand.
Finally, feel free to update your profile picture periodically. This keeps your profile fresh and allows you to reflect changes in your style or aesthetic, showing your growth on the platform!

5. Crafting a Captivating Bio for Your VSCO Profile
Your bio is the first impression people get when they visit your VSCO profile, so it’s essential to make it count! A captivating bio can reflect your personality, showcase your style, and even hint at what viewers can expect from your visual content. Here are some pointers to help you craft the perfect bio:
- Keep it Short and Sweet: Aim for brevity. A concise bio packs a punch! Think of it as your elevator pitch, ideally under 150 characters.
- Show Your Personality: Use a tone that reflects who you are—whether it’s quirky, artistic, or professional. Emojis can add flair and warmth!
- Highlight Your Passion: What drives you? Photography, travel, fashion? Let your audience know what topics to expect in your posts.
- Add a Call to Action: Encourage viewers to explore your work. Phrases like “Follow my journey” or “Check out my latest shots!” can be effective.
Remember to update your bio periodically. As you evolve, so should your profile. Since VSCO is all about visual storytelling, think of your bio as a brief introduction to the narrative you want to convey through your images!

6. Utilizing Filters and Editing Tools Effectively
One of the standout features of VSCO is its vast array of filters and editing tools that can elevate your photos from ordinary to breathtaking. Understanding how to use these tools effectively can greatly impact the overall aesthetic of your profile. Here are some tips to get you started:
- Choose the Right Filter: Filters can dramatically change the mood of your images. Experiment with different ones to find those that complement your unique style. Don't be afraid to try multiple filters to see which one enhances your photo best!
- Adjust Intensity: Many filters allow for intensity adjustments. A small tweak can lead to a more personalized touch while retaining the original vibe of the photo.
- Explore Editing Tools: Beyond filters, VSCO offers tools like exposure, contrast, saturation, and sharpening. Learn how to balance these elements for a polished look.
- Consistency is Key: Develop a signature editing style. Whether you prefer moody contrasts or bright, airy tones, consistency in your editing approach ensures your profile feels cohesive.
Ultimately, the goal is to enhance your images without overshadowing the original subject. The beauty of VSCO lies in its ability to create artful representations of reality. So dive in, experiment, and find the perfect balance for your aesthetic!

8. Showcasing Your Work Through Collections
One of the most effective ways to enhance your VSCO profile is by showcasing your work through Collections. A collection allows you to group your photos together based on a theme, project, or mood, making it easier for viewers to appreciate the story behind your art. Here’s how to create impactful collections:
- Thematic Grouping: Create collections based on common themes, such as "Nature," "Urban Life," or "Travel Adventures." This helps viewers quickly find the genre they’re interested in.
- Curate Thoughtfully: Choose your best works for each collection and consider how they complement each other. A well-curated collection speaks volumes about your artistic vision.
- Keep Titles Engaging: Give your collections catchy names that reflect their content. A title like "Wanderlust Chronicles" can attract fellow travelers or adventure seekers.
- Update Regularly: Refresh your collections with new photos to keep them relevant. This shows your growth as a photographer and keeps your audience engaged.
By effectively showcasing your work through collections on VSCO, not only do you practice good organization, but you also create a deeper connection with your audience. A well-curated collection invites viewers to explore your work more fully and helps establish your personal brand in the community.
